6-bromo-N-(7-methyl-2-phenylimidazo[1,2-a]pyridin-3-yl)-2-oxochromene-3-carboxamide

Also Known As: ChemDiv1_005399, 6-bromo-N-(7-methyl-2-phenylimidazo[1,2-a]pyridin-3-yl)-2-oxo-2H-chromene-3-carboxamide, 6-bromo-N-{7-methyl-2-phenylimidazo[1,2-a]pyridin-3-yl}-2-oxo-2H-chromene-3-carboxamide, 6-bromo-N-(7-methyl-2-phenylimidazo[1,2-a]pyridin-3-yl)-2-oxochromene-3-carboxamide, 6-BROMO-N-{7-METHYL-2-PHENYLIMIDAZO[1,2-A]PYRIDIN-3-YL}-2-OXOCHROMENE-3-CARBOXAMIDE

CAS: 306285-30-3
Molecular Formula C24H16BrN3O3
Molecular Weight 473.04 g/mol
LogP 5.43092
Topological Polar Surface Area 76.61 Ų
Hydrogen Bond Donors 1
Hydrogen Bond Acceptors 4
Rotatable Bonds 3
Exact Mass 473.0375
Heavy Atoms 31
Complexity 1520.4813

Chemical Identifiers

CAS Number 306285-30-3
SMILES CC1=CC2=NC(=C(N2C=C1)NC(=O)C3=CC4=C(C=CC(=C4)Br)OC3=O)C5=CC=CC=C5

Property Insights of ChemDiv1_005399

The XLogP value of 5.43092 indicates that ChemDiv1_005399 is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 76.61 Ų falls within the moderate polarity range, balancing permeability and solubility for ChemDiv1_005399. Following Lipinski's Rule of Five, ChemDiv1_005399 has 1 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
